Default End of song

As a new user of Notation2 I have, by accident, put the "End of song" lines somewhere in the middle of my song. Whatever I try I can't remove it.

What's the trick?

Default Re: End of song

Hi, Gerard:

You should be able just to click-drag across the barline and select another from the menu of barlines that will appear at the top left of the screen.

Or click-drag across it and press "1" for a single barline, "2" for a double, etc.

Hope that works for you.
